1. Car Parking Multiplayer

Car Parking Multiplayer is more than just a parking simulator; it’s an open-world driving experience in which players may explore realistic landscapes, modify their vehicles, and take part in a variety of activities. The game’s major focus is parking, but it also includes online multiplayer, vehicle trade, and free-world exploration.

Strengths

  • The game has a dynamic environment in which players can drive through a complex metropolis. Gas stations, parking lots, and even pedestrian interactions add to the game’s sense of life.
  • Unlike other automobile parking games, this one allows players to interact with each other in real time. Whether you want to race or just show off your driving abilities, the multiplayer mode keeps the game interesting.
  • Players can select from a range of vehicles and tweak everything from engine performance to appearance. This modification brings a personal touch to the gameplay.
  • The game focuses on precision parking, making it both tough and rewarding. The many parking scenarios allow players to enhance their real-world parking skills.

Weaknesses

  • While not bad, the graphics could be improved compared to other recent automobile simulation games.
  • If you prefer racing to parking, you may find the game’s concentration not enough. There are fewer racing possibilities than in games that make racing the major action.
  • Some of the more advanced cars and features are hidden behind paywalls, which might detract from the overall experience for those who prefer free-to-play games.

2. Forza Horizon 5

Forza Horizon 5 builds on its predecessors’ strengths by providing one of the most expansive open-world driving experiences available in a vehicle simulation game. Players can explore a diverse range of locations in a bright, detailed representation of Mexico, from lush jungles to arid deserts. The game’s beautiful visuals and arcade-style driving mechanics have made it a cult favorite.

Strengths

  • The game’s surroundings are amazing in that every place seems distinct, and the dynamic weather system adds an extra element of authenticity.
  • From muscle cars to hyper cars, Forza Horizon 5 has over 500 vehicles, each with its own distinct feel and personalization choices.
  • The multiplayer option enables seamless integration with other people, whether you’re competing in races or simply drifting about the planet together.

Weaknesses

  • While the game provides a great driving experience, it has more of an arcade feel than a true simulation. As a result, serious enthusiasts may dislike the car’s physics.
  • To truly enjoy Forza Horizon 5, you’ll need powerful gear, particularly at higher resolutions and settings.

3. Gran Turismo 7

Gran Turismo 7 is the latest edition in the long-running series, which is noted for its emphasis on realism. Gran Turismo 7, with its large automobile selection and accurate driving characteristics, is regarded as one of the best car simulation games for people seeking a genuine driving experience. The game strikes a balance between imitating real-world automotive mechanics and offering an enjoyable and interesting driving experience.

Strengths

  • The driving mechanics are extremely lifelike, with extreme care to detail in handling, braking, and vehicle weight.
  • Players can drive everything from common sedans to exotic supercars, thanks to hundreds of vehicles from various manufacturers.
  • The game’s online component is extensive, with frequent tournaments and competitive racing against people from all around the world.

Weaknesses

  • Unlocking higher-tier vehicles can take time, and some players may find the grind boring.
  • The game is mostly centered on track racing, so those expecting additional off-road alternatives may be disappointed.

4. Project CARS 3

Project CARS 3 takes the franchise in a somewhat new direction, providing a more accessible racing experience while retaining some simulation features from earlier games. With a diverse selection of circuits and automobiles, it caters to both die-hard racing enthusiasts and casual players.

Strengths

  • Project CARS 3 provides a diverse choice of racing venues, including well-known circuits and innovative new tracks.
  • Racing in various weather conditions, including rain and fog, lends an element of uncertainty to each race.
  • While Project CARS 3 remains a simulation at heart, it is easier to get into than previous games in the series, making it more accessible to beginners.

Weaknesses

  • Compared to prior entries, Project CARS 3 feels more arcade-like, which may turn off gamers who appreciated the previous games’ tough simulation elements.
  • In comparison to other racing games, the career mode lacks depth and complexity.

5. Assetto Corsa

Assetto Corsa is revered by hardcore sim racing fans for its unparalleled realism. With its focus on delivering authentic driving physics, Assetto Corsa is often the go-to game for players who want to fine-tune their driving skills on the most challenging tracks.

Strengths

  • The game’s physics engine is among the most advanced in any automobile simulation game, providing realistic handling and braking.
  • Assetto Corsa offers an exceptionally lifelike driving experience to those who use VR headsets.
  • Assetto Corsa’s robust modding community ensures that gamers always have access to new vehicles, tracks, and features contributed by fellow fans.

Weaknesses

  • Newcomers to racing simulations may find the game’s physics challenging to grasp.
  • While the driving mechanics are excellent, the game’s graphics have started to show their age, especially in comparison to more recent releases.

6. F1 2023

F1 2023 brings the thrill of Formula 1 racing to your home, with all the official teams, drivers, and circuits from the 2023 season. For fans of open-wheel racing, this is one of the best simulations available.

Strengths

  • The game recreates the Formula One experience down to the finest detail, from car handling to racing strategy.
  • Weather conditions have a big impact on races, and the game’s dynamic weather system adds to the realism.
  • The extensive career mode allows players to shape their legacy, with actions influencing everything from team dynamics to race results.

Weaknesses

  • The game’s simulation-heavy style may intimidate newbies to the sport.
  • If you are not an F1 fan, the game’s emphasis on realism and official F1 content may not appeal to you.

7. The Crew 2

The Crew 2 offers a diverse world to allow players to drive cars, boats, and planes. It is an amazing game that gives an advantage to pliers to switch between different types of vehicles, making for a unique and varied gameplay experience.

Strengths

  • The game provides a detailed replica of the United States, allowing players to drive coast to coast in a variety of vehicles.
  • In addition to vehicles, players can fly planes, boats, and motorcycles, giving the game a distinct spin on the car simulation genre.
  • The game has a variety of activities, including street races, off-road trials, and more.

Weaknesses

  • While entertaining, the driving mechanics are less realistic than those seen in other simulation games.
  • Some of the better cars in the game are hidden behind paywalls, stifling advancement for free-to-play users.

8. BeamNG.drive

BeamNG.drive is an amazing simulation game which focuses on soft-body physics, which allows for highly realistic car crashes and vehicle damage. While the game lacks the structured races found in other simulators, it excels at providing a sandbox environment where players can test vehicles and create their own challenges.

Strengths

  • Its crash dynamics are breathtakingly realistic, making it a notable element in the vehicle simulation genre.
  • The game allows users to design their own driving settings and experiments, making it an ideal tool for creative players.
  • Its modding community is continually creating new vehicles, tracks, and challenges.

Weaknesses

  • Unlike other simulation games, BeamNG.drive does not have traditional races, which may throw off competitive gamers.
  • Mastering the game’s physics system takes time and can be unpleasant for inexperienced players.

9. Need for Speed Heat

Need for Speed Heat delivers the excitement of street racing to a fictitious version of Miami. The game has a day-night cycle, with players able to compete in recognized races during the day and illegal street races at night.

Strengths

  • The game features high-octane street racing that is both exciting and demanding.
  • Players can fully personalize their vehicles, from paint schemes to performance boosts.
  • The transition from day to night affects gameplay, with police crackdowns getting more aggressive during night racing.

Weaknesses

  • While entertaining, the game’s arcade-style driving mechanics may turn off sim enthusiasts who prefer a more realistic experience.
  • Unlike some of the other games on this list, Need for Speed Heat’s vehicle damage is minor and has no significant impact on performance.

10. Euro Truck Simulator 2

Euro Truck Simulator 2 provides a unique driving experience, focusing on long-haul trucking across Europe. The game is mostly a logistics and management simulator, but it features realistic driving mechanics and a surprisingly pleasant gaming cycle.

Strengths

  • The game provides a highly realistic trucking experience, with weight distribution, fuel management, and traffic restrictions.
  • Players can drive through a realistic map of Europe, delivering goods and managing their trucking firm.
  • Unlike other automotive simulation games that emphasize speed and racing, Euro Truck Simulator 2 is ideal for those seeking a more relaxed driving experience.

Weaknesses

  • Players seeking fast-paced action may find the game’s emphasis on trucking and logistics too slow.
  • The game’s emphasis on transportation may not appeal to enthusiasts of classic automobile simulation games.
